In the meantime, here is what you need to get started:
- 2 or 3 – Basic Grey Eskimo Kisses Powdered Sugar paper
- 2 – Basic Grey Eskimo Kisses Peppermint Twist paper
- 1 – Basic Grey Eskimo Kisses Starry Night paper
- 1 – Basic Grey Eskimo Kisses Alpine paper
- 1 – Basic Grey Eskimo Kisses Glazed Apple paper
- 2 – Basic Grey Eskimo Kisses Woodland paper
- 1 – Basic Grey Eskimo Kisses Snow Cap paper
- 1 – Basic Grey Eskimo Kisses Evergreen paper
- 1 – Basic Grey Eskimo Kisses Green Doilie
- 1 – Basic Grey Eskimo Kisses Chip Sticker Shapes
- 1 – Basic Grey Eskimo Kisses Stitched Brads
- 1 – Basic Grey Eskimo Kisses Metal Brads
- 1 – Basic Grey Holly Jolly Itsy Bitsy Stamp
- 1 – Basic Grey Designer Rhinestones Ruby Snowflake
- 1 – Basic Grey Designer Rhinestones Rudy Swirl
- 1 – Paper Mache House (I bought mine at Hobby Lobby)
Also used: Liquid glue or double stick tape, brown ink pad, scissors, pop dots, Tattered Angels Glimmer Mist (iridescent gold), Stickles Glitter Glue, ¾” wood block (to hold up chipboard people), craft boa from craft store for snow (12 feet), QuicKutz Nesting Squares die.
